Wipro denies bid to acquire Capgemini

Indian outsourcer Wipro has stated that it has not been in talks to acquire or merge with French IT services company, Capgemini. It had been widely reported that Wipro, India’s third largest outsourcer, was considering acquiring Capgemini.

Wipro issued a statement at the request of French securities regulator, Autorité des marchés financiers (AMF).

Capgemini’s share price rose in December after the The Hindustan Times reported that Wipro was expected to bid for Capgemini by the end of January. A Capgemini spokesperson denied at the time that there were any talks between Wipro and Capgemini on this issue. It was also been reported earlier in 2007 that Infosys was planning a bid for Capgemini.

As part of plans to create a global delivery model, Indian outsourcers are moving into the European market.
